7 Essential Steps in the Website Development Process for Business Success

← Back to posts
7 Essential Steps in the Website Development Process for Business Success

7 Essential Steps in the Website Development Process for Business Success

Published: 2025-02-12 11:07:56

Web development is a skill that requires years of education, hands-on experience, and continuous learning to master. Most business owners struggle with where to begin when it comes to building a website that is both functional and visually appealing.

That’s where we come in! At Promfly, we have a team of expert web developers dedicated to creating high-performing websites tailored to business needs. Our professionals bring diverse skills and extensive experience, having worked on numerous custom web development projects across industries, both locally and internationally.

In this article, we’ll walk you through the seven crucial steps of the website development process. 

Stay tuned as we break down each step to help you build a website that ranks well on search engines, drives traffic, and converts visitors into customers.

What Is Website Development? 

Website development encompasses the process of creating, designing, and maintaining websites to ensure functionality, performance, and user experience.

At its core, web development involves coding and web markup using languages like HTML, CSS, and JavaScript. However, it goes beyond just coding—it also includes content management system (CMS) integration, eCommerce development, website migrations, security enhancements, and performance optimization. 

A well-developed website not only looks visually appealing but also functions seamlessly, ensuring a smooth user experience and strong search engine visibility.

What Is Website Development?
 

The Website Development Process In 7 Steps:

From planning to launch, we’ve broken the website development process into seven key steps to follow. But before we dive in, here’s a quick flowchart to help visualize the process.

1. Define Your Project

The first step in website development is to define your project goals. This includes:

  • Business Details: Outline your offerings, unique value proposition, mission, vision, and key stakeholders.
  • Business Goals: Set clear, measurable objectives for your website, including key performance indicators (KPIs) to track success.
  • Target Audience: Research your ideal customers, their preferences, online behaviors, and expectations.
  • Competition Analysis: Study your competitors, analyze their strengths and weaknesses, and create a strategy to position your brand effectively.

2. Plan Your Website

The planning stage involves defining your website’s layout, including landing pages, product pages, and conversion points. This step includes:

  • Sitemap Creation: A sitemap outlines the structure of your website, helping organize pages and improve navigation for both users and search engines.
  • Wireframes: A wireframe is a blueprint for each page, defining content placement, headlines, calls to action (CTAs), and design elements. Wireframes should be created for both desktop and mobile versions.

Proper planning helps optimize the user journey and improves your website’s conversion funnel.

3. Design Your Website

The design stage brings your brand identity to life with a strong user interface (UI) and engaging visuals.

Define and maintain consistency in elements like:

  • Color Palette & Branding: Ensure your website design aligns with your brand identity.
  • Logos & Icons: Use brand-specific logos and icons across digital platforms.
  • Visuals & Media: Incorporate high-quality images, videos, and other interactive elements to enhance user experience.

A consistent brand identity across all digital channels, including social media and marketing materials, increases brand recognition and builds trust.

4. Create Content

Content is crucial for engaging users and driving conversions. Based on your target audience, create content such as:

  • Landing pages
  • Product or service descriptions
  • Testimonials and case studies
  • Blog posts
  • Videos and images
  • Newsletters
  • White papers
  • Social media posts

Use SEO best practices by incorporating relevant keywords and optimizing content to match search intent. Well-structured, engaging content increases visibility and enhances your website’s authority.

5. Develop Your Website

Once your goals, design, and content are set, it’s time for development.

  • Frontend & Backend Development: Web developers use advanced coding practices to bring your website to life.
  • Platform Selection: Choose a CMS or framework that supports scalability and performance.
  • Feature Integration: Include essential functionalities such as eCommerce, contact forms, and analytics tracking.

At Promfly, our experts build custom websites using industry best practices to ensure high performance, security, and seamless functionality.

6. Test Your Website

Before launching, thorough testing is crucial to ensure your website functions smoothly across all devices and browsers.

  • Bug & Error Checks: Identify and fix broken links, UI/UX issues, and compatibility problems.
  • Speed & Performance Testing: Optimize website loading times to improve user experience and SEO rankings.
  • Mobile Responsiveness: Ensure seamless navigation on all screen sizes.

Once manual and automated testing is complete, your website is ready to go live.

7. Maintain Your Website

Launching your website is just the beginning. Ongoing maintenance is essential for security, performance, and keeping up with industry trends.

Regular website maintenance includes:

  • Updating and adding new content
  • Fixing bugs and security issues
  • Performing site backups
  • Installing necessary plugins and updates

The digital landscape evolves constantly, and staying ahead requires continuous optimization. At Promfly, we provide regular updates, maintenance, and SEO enhancements to keep your website performing at its best.

20 Tools to Streamline the Website Development Process

Website development involves multiple tasks, from designing and coding to testing and deployment. Using the right tools can significantly improve efficiency, ensuring a smooth and streamlined process. 

<strong>20 Tools to Streamline the Website Development Process</strong>

Whether you're a developer, designer, or project manager, these 20 tools will help enhance productivity and collaboration.

1. Planning & Project Management Tools for Website Development Process 

  1. Trello – A simple, visual tool for organizing tasks and managing workflows.
  2. Asana – A powerful project management tool for tracking deadlines and team collaboration.
  3. Monday.com – Helps teams manage web development projects with customizable workflows.
  4. Notion – A versatile tool for documentation, task tracking, and collaboration.

2. Design & Prototyping Tools

  1. Figma – A cloud-based design tool for real-time collaboration on UI/UX designs.
  2. Adobe XD – A robust tool for designing and prototyping website interfaces.
  3. Sketch – Ideal for vector-based UI/UX design, particularly for macOS users.
  4. Canva – A beginner-friendly tool for creating graphics and visual elements for websites.

3. Website Development & Coding Tools

  1. Visual Studio Code – A lightweight yet powerful code editor with built-in debugging.
  2. Sublime Text – A fast and customizable code editor with a rich plugin ecosystem.
  3. GitHub – A version control platform that helps teams collaborate on coding projects.
  4. CodePen – An online coding environment for front-end development experimentation.

4. Content Management & Development Platforms

  1. WordPress – The most popular CMS for building dynamic and scalable websites.
  2. Webflow – A no-code tool for designing, developing, and launching websites.
  3. Shopify – The go-to platform for building eCommerce websites.
  4. Magento – A robust eCommerce platform designed for scalability and flexibility.

5. Testing & Optimization Tools

  1. Google Lighthouse – A tool for assessing website performance, accessibility, and SEO.
  2. GTmetrix – Analyzes website speed and provides optimization suggestions.
  3. BrowserStack – Tests website compatibility across multiple browsers and devices.
  4. Pingdom – Monitors website uptime and performance in real time.

By leveraging these tools, developers and businesses can streamline the website development process, improve efficiency, and create high-performing, visually appealing websites. Whether you're a beginner or an expert, integrating the right tools into your workflow will lead to better results.

7 Website Development Process Checklist 2025

website development checklist ensures that every stage of the process is well-organized and nothing is overlooked. Here’s what to include:

  1. Planning & Research – Define goals, target audience, competitors, and sitemap.
  2. Design & UI/UX – Create wireframes, select branding elements, and optimize for user experience.
  3. Content Creation – Develop SEO-friendly text, images, videos, and call-to-action elements.
  4. Development & Coding – Implement frontend and backend functionality, mobile responsiveness, and security measures.
  5. Testing & Optimization – Check for speed, broken links, cross-browser compatibility, and bug fixes.
  6. Launch & Maintenance – Set up Google Analytics, Optimize for SEO, and schedule Regular Updates.

 

A well-structured checklist ensures a smooth website launch and long-term success.

Website Development Process At Promfly

Website Development Process At Promfly
 

At Promfly, we follow a streamlined website development process to ensure your business stands out online. From initial consultation to the final product, we work closely with you to understand your goals. 

Our process begins with in-depth research, including audience analysis and competitor review. Next, we design and develop a custom website that is both user-friendly and visually appealing. 

Once the site is live, we focus on optimization, ensuring seamless performance across all devices. With Promfly, your website will not only look great but also drive engagement and deliver measurable results for your business.

Website Development Process Cycle at Promfly

  1. In-depth Research
    • Audience analysis
    • Competitor review
  2. Custom Website Design & Development
    • User-friendly interface
    • Visually appealing design
  3. Optimization for Seamless Performance
    • Cross-device compatibility
    • Speed and performance improvements

Once your website is live, we focus on ongoing optimization to ensure it continues to drive engagement and deliver measurable results for your business.

 

Website Development Process Takeaways 

The website development process is a comprehensive journey that involves several key stages to ensure a successful end product. First, it’s important to conduct thorough research, understanding your target audience, business objectives, and competitors. 

This lays the foundation for a tailored design and development strategy. The design phase focuses on creating an intuitive and visually appealing user experience, while the development phase brings your website to life using the latest technologies.

Optimization plays a critical role in ensuring fast loading times, mobile responsiveness, and excellent user experience. Testing ensures that the website functions smoothly across all devices and browsers. Finally, after launching the site, continuous monitoring and updates are essential to keep the website running efficiently and effectively.

By following a structured process like this, businesses can create a website that not only meets their goals but also provides a platform for growth, increased traffic, and higher conversions

FAQs 
 

1. How to Develop a Website?
To develop a website, define your goals, design the layout, develop the site’s code, test for performance, and launch. Regular maintenance ensures it stays up-to-date.

2. What is Web Page Development?
Web page development involves creating individual pages, focusing on layout, content, and functionality, ensuring responsiveness and optimization.

3. What Are the Web Development Steps?
The steps include planning (defining goals), design (creating wireframes), development (coding the site), testing (ensuring functionality), launch (deploying the site), and ongoing maintenance.

Conclusion

In conclusion, the website development process is a crucial journey that requires careful planning, design, development, testing, and ongoing maintenance. By following a structured approach, businesses can ensure their website not only meets their objectives but also delivers a seamless user experience that drives engagement and conversions. 

At Promfly, we understand the intricacies of web development and are committed to creating high-performing, visually appealing websites tailored to your business needs. 

With continuous optimization and support, we help businesses stay ahead in the ever-evolving digital landscape, ensuring your website remains a powerful tool for growth and success.

 

Want to know more?  for details.

Web Designer vs Web Developer Salary in India: An In-Depth Comparison

Why Our Website Development Services Are the Best for Your Business Growth

Why Choose Our Shopify Development Services to Scale Your Business?

Latest Post